/**
* `<hc-entity-form>` — create / edit form for a single entity.
*
* Props:
* .entityId — pre-populated when editing; empty for create
* .state — pre-populated state value
* .attributes — pre-populated JSON object
* .editing — true to lock entity_id (HA wire-compat doesn't rename)
*
* Emits:
* hc-entity-submit detail: { entity_id, state, attributes }
* hc-entity-cancel
*
* Validation (client-side; backend validates again):
* - entity_id matches /^[a-z][a-z0-9_]*\.[a-z][a-z0-9_]*$/
* - state is non-empty
* - attributes parses as a JSON object (not array, not scalar)
*/
import { LitElement, html, css } from 'lit';
import { customElement, property, state } from 'lit/decorators.js';
const ENTITY_ID_RE = /^[a-z][a-z0-9_]*\.[a-z][a-z0-9_]*$/;
/**
* Known Home Assistant domain prefixes. We don't reject unknown domains
* (the API accepts any matching the regex), but unknown ones get a
* warning so the operator sees what's standard. Add new domains here
* as integrations land.
*/
const KNOWN_DOMAINS = new Set([
'sensor', 'binary_sensor', 'switch', 'light', 'climate', 'cover',
'fan', 'media_player', 'lock', 'camera', 'vacuum', 'humidifier',
'water_heater', 'scene', 'script', 'automation', 'input_boolean',
'input_number', 'input_text', 'input_select', 'input_datetime',
'person', 'device_tracker', 'zone', 'sun', 'weather', 'calendar',
'remote', 'siren', 'select', 'number', 'text', 'button',
'homeassistant', 'homecore', 'group', 'notify', 'tts', 'alarm_control_panel',
]);
type FieldValidity = { ok: true } | { ok: false; level: 'err' | 'warn'; msg: string };
function validateEntityId(id: string): FieldValidity {
const trimmed = id.trim();
if (!trimmed) return { ok: false, level: 'err', msg: 'required' };
if (!ENTITY_ID_RE.test(trimmed)) {
return {
ok: false,
level: 'err',
msg: 'must match domain.snake_case (lowercase, digits, underscores)',
};
}
const domain = trimmed.split('.')[0]!;
if (!KNOWN_DOMAINS.has(domain)) {
return {
ok: false,
level: 'warn',
msg: `unknown domain "${domain}" — HA-standard domains include sensor / light / switch / binary_sensor / climate`,
};
}
return { ok: true };
}
function validateState(s: string): FieldValidity {
if (!s.trim()) return { ok: false, level: 'err', msg: 'required' };
return { ok: true };
}
function validateAttrs(raw: string): FieldValidity {
if (!raw.trim()) return { ok: true }; // empty = {}
try {
const parsed = JSON.parse(raw);
if (typeof parsed !== 'object' || Array.isArray(parsed) || parsed === null) {
return { ok: false, level: 'err', msg: 'must be a JSON object (not array, not scalar)' };
}
return { ok: true };
} catch (e) {
return { ok: false, level: 'err', msg: `JSON parse: ${e instanceof Error ? e.message : String(e)}` };
}
}

/**
* `<hc-modal>` — minimal accessible overlay modal.
*
* Open / close by setting the `open` property. Closes on Escape and
* on backdrop click. Content goes in the default slot; an optional
* named "footer" slot is rendered below the content.
*
* Emits `hc-modal-close` on close so the host can clean up.
*/
